Bonian Chen
e9324b48ab
Merge "[Settings] Replacing accessing of PhoneConstants$DataState"
2020-01-15 14:56:36 +00:00
Bonian Chen
58ed9710c7
Remove reference of PhoneConstant.
...
Copy constants to ApnEditor from PhoneConstant
Test: make
Test: m RunSettingsRoboTests
Change-Id: Idb26ded937dd31f08c96323d5064947a6af86156
Merged-In: I22b85799ad547aca1ce4e63af3f39bc7f29618c6
2020-01-15 21:52:43 +08:00
Bonian Chen
368c885b98
[Settings] Remove unused ImsStatusPreferenceController
...
Legacy code clean up.
Bug: 147534443
Test: build pass
Change-Id: I4dd9c1c623296385eab6e14c10956cea27a04f75
2020-01-15 20:50:24 +08:00
Bonian Chen
8845af8a14
[Settings] Replacing accessing of PhoneConstants$DataState
...
1. Replaced by PhoneStateListner#onPreciseDataConnectionStateChanged().
2. Remove usage of hidden API SubscriptionManager#getPhoneId()
Bug: 147080692
Test: manual
Change-Id: I6e7c9910ed63e027fc02c1835853175745b31b66
2020-01-14 01:18:50 +08:00
Kevin Chang
01357b5b73
Modify the code logic of OnLayoutChangeListener in Caption preferences
...
Remove the listener and add statement to refresh the text when the caption turns on.
Bug: 142632389
Test: Manual
Change-Id: Ic5711309c5b8af9834e5439d825b4cb2ed55fe01
Merged-In: Ic5711309c5b8af9834e5439d825b4cb2ed55fe01
2020-01-13 10:10:36 +08:00
Sarah Chin
5ce99e22ff
Merge "5G meteredness for telephony framework"
2020-01-10 16:36:48 +00:00
changbetty
4bdbd135fb
[Mainline] Use the @SystemApi setAlwaysAllowMmsData in TelephonyManager for mainline
...
Bug: 146309719
Test: make RunSettingsRoboTests ROBOTEST_FILTER=MmsMessagePreferenceControllerTest
Change-Id: Ia591e82e1a55f36c98e7b00965532ff0762e1e77
Merged-In: Ia591e82e1a55f36c98e7b00965532ff0762e1e77
2020-01-10 17:15:09 +08:00
Sarah Chin
9ea18281ee
5G meteredness for telephony framework
...
Bug: 139070884
Test: atest FrameworksTelephonyTests
Change-Id: I0c8e84f74fd1f69ffc7e1046819966fcb04732a6
Merged-In: I0c8e84f74fd1f69ffc7e1046819966fcb04732a6
(cherry picked from commit 0c518d5aab )
2020-01-10 05:53:22 +00:00
Automerger Merge Worker
c0b3551310
Merge "[Settings] Avoid from accessing createManageSubscriptionIntent(int)" am: d792d20001 am: 77cc57d9c2
...
Change-Id: Id34a3b5da71400c651e3a05198210acae155067c
2020-01-09 06:15:54 +00:00
Bonian Chen
d792d20001
Merge "[Settings] Avoid from accessing createManageSubscriptionIntent(int)"
2020-01-09 06:00:05 +00:00
Sarah Chin
f7d2691e1e
Merge "Handle 5G meteredness in telephony framework"
2020-01-09 05:03:24 +00:00
Automerger Merge Worker
d0401b1883
Merge "MAP: Add developer option to control map version" am: a24f03d58e am: d8e0b57e3a
...
Change-Id: I91537221abd287ca66fbc5b1d945b8a464b3e3de
2020-01-09 03:46:22 +00:00
Treehugger Robot
a24f03d58e
Merge "MAP: Add developer option to control map version"
2020-01-09 03:00:28 +00:00
Automerger Merge Worker
46f5e64f94
Merge "Removed reference to RadioAccessFamily" am: b13a4ef322 am: d934d5eda2
...
Change-Id: I1b13f79040ba776e8a0c763280d4fc3f89e3f373
2020-01-09 02:26:28 +00:00
Sarah Chin
0904e65eb8
Merge "Handle 5G meteredness in telephony framework" into qt-qpr1-dev-plus-aosp
2020-01-09 02:23:13 +00:00
Treehugger Robot
b13a4ef322
Merge "Removed reference to RadioAccessFamily"
2020-01-09 02:09:10 +00:00
Automerger Merge Worker
b85d1971bf
Merge "Fix policy for platform compat UI" am: 3208f994c1 am: e184ff6028
...
Change-Id: If560c3b115101910ab4e7e2976463ebd30d79d1b
2020-01-08 18:54:09 +00:00
Andrei-Valentin Onea
3208f994c1
Merge "Fix policy for platform compat UI"
2020-01-08 18:42:44 +00:00
Automerger Merge Worker
db65d2b0b2
Merge "[Settings] Remove IMS factoryReset()" am: bf3aaf0f37 am: dc4e189dbc
...
Change-Id: I019d3a5df41512a142a4745b4d56a53b73a05c60
2020-01-08 18:25:01 +00:00
Andrei Onea
96de9d4cac
Fix policy for platform compat UI
...
Only show debuggable apps on user builds. Also, only enable changes that
are overrideable.
Bug: 138280620
Bug: 144552011
Test: Settings->Developer Options->App Compatibility Changes on user
build
Test: atest PlatformCompatDashboardTest
Exempt-From-Owner-Approval: Previously approved
Change-Id: Ibf9611d1809492ebe979fc55f9331daf78ca9b27
2020-01-08 16:44:36 +00:00
Bonian Chen
31e07211d9
[Settings] Avoid from accessing createManageSubscriptionIntent(int)
...
Avoid from accessing
SubscriptionManager#createManageSubscriptionIntent(int).
Create a copy of source code into Settings.
Bug: 147334060
Test: make RunSettingsRoboTests -j ROBOTEST_FILTER=DataUsageSummaryPreferenceControllerTest
Change-Id: Id44a6b214a8f5d378d7a536fbf984a0512e6a92d
2020-01-08 23:32:30 +08:00
Bonian Chen
4fa40aed87
[Settings] Remove IMS factoryReset()
...
IMS factoryReset() has been done within
TelephonyManager.resetSettings().
Bug: 147342492
Test: manual
Change-Id: Ic17b8235e76a4bcf3e6bf5329a88477697a33c51
Merged-In: Id5c868726189397fc2a85717326e56e055b640af
2020-01-08 14:15:37 +00:00
Lee Chou
373b43c16e
Removed reference to RadioAccessFamily
...
1. Removed reference to RadioAccessFamily#getNetworkTypeFromRaf,
RadioAccessFamily#getRafFromNetworkType
2. Migrated hidden NETWORK_MODE_* constants in TelephonyManager
Bug: 147079703
Test: build and test manually
Change-Id: I94745edc37d80336197f874cb7b4afd42dfc97a8
2020-01-08 19:13:47 +08:00
Chienyuan
01f4f8432e
MAP: Add developer option to control map version
...
Bug: 146916756
Test: manual
Change-Id: I6015e5dae8e2c19549babe556b84a2c5b24dd669
Merged-In: If32db03072e02b7b2477c7da943b6b0e6a9be260
2020-01-08 17:04:25 +08:00
Automerger Merge Worker
74baf75975
Merge "[Settings] Remove access to getSimOperator() API" am: cd4113ba5c am: 5113ada6ab
...
Change-Id: I54323620052496d6cb82d65623eed0a0404f9d45
2020-01-07 18:31:09 +00:00
Bonian Chen
cd4113ba5c
Merge "[Settings] Remove access to getSimOperator() API"
2020-01-07 18:06:40 +00:00
Automerger Merge Worker
30fa13d592
Merge "[Settings] Remove PhoneStateIntentReceiver" am: 1a3ed7a560 am: dbc6a6395e
...
Change-Id: Iece6ca294d5c52595b3ad249a2ea1a09ae0a6e8d
2020-01-07 16:40:17 +00:00
Bonian Chen
1a3ed7a560
Merge "[Settings] Remove PhoneStateIntentReceiver"
2020-01-07 16:21:01 +00:00
Bonian Chen
7d31f16e0f
[Settings] Remove access to getSimOperator() API
...
Replace getSimOperator() by having SubscriptionInfo
from ProxySubscriptionManager#getActiveSubscriptionInfo().
Bug: 144263441
Test: Manual
Test: make RunSettingsRoboTests -j ROBOTEST_FILTER=ApnEditorTest
Change-Id: I132b352dfb50a9cd3a2ddd21b347177ac0332740
Merged-In: I25cc9dc0912564b8d6f8b23b53f3eb20a51eea32
2020-01-07 12:44:30 +00:00
Bonian Chen
e520ec60aa
[Settings] Remove PhoneStateIntentReceiver
...
1. Replace PhoneStateIntentReceiver by adopting PhoneStateListener
2. Replace TelephonyProperties.in_ecm_mode() by
TelephonyManager.getEmergencyCallbackMode()
Bug: 144331663
Change-Id: Ib127cb165c65f50851c4390b05a16dfb8024fab1
Bug: 145830780
Test: Manual
Test: make RunSettingsRoboTests -j ROBOTEST_FILTER=AirplaneModeEnabler
Merged-In: Ib39ab1881484f65bc5a3834b2828c6ba98198cca
2020-01-02 18:26:21 +08:00
Automerger Merge Worker
08b42adf46
Merge "[Settings] Correct spelling in source code" am: 22c5c7d4a4 am: 42a1f866e4
...
Change-Id: Iac65c4fb8ded870857207c316946535f4ec87a5f
2019-12-30 07:35:49 +00:00
Bonian Chen
22c5c7d4a4
Merge "[Settings] Correct spelling in source code"
2019-12-30 07:18:59 +00:00
Automerger Merge Worker
c30575610c
Merge "Changed reference of telecom.Log to util.Log" am: f9d06dc434 am: 2bffc2754a
...
Change-Id: Ic36bfe8db4edba2a80353a9d4fa66027e5d92364
2019-12-30 04:59:08 +00:00
Lee Chou
f9d06dc434
Merge "Changed reference of telecom.Log to util.Log"
2019-12-30 04:36:18 +00:00
Bonian Chen
b14af41430
[Settings] Correct spelling in source code
...
Rename mSubsciptionsMonitor into mSubscriptionMonitor.
Test: build pass
Change-Id: Ib0444c61fbe4238f743bf83f6ff96656be433c9d
2019-12-30 10:27:57 +08:00
Lee Chou
1c5f319f3c
Changed reference of telecom.Log to util.Log
...
Bug: 146912511
Test: make and test manually
Change-Id: Ibc077c71c6181cf7724279fd73e4370aaf8fefa1
2019-12-27 17:12:18 +08:00
Automerger Merge Worker
cd46f2df4f
Merge "[Settings] Replace getSimCount() API" am: b0bddfec15 am: 92f25fadd2
...
Change-Id: I709109c86262dcc6886ccd2dbccf84fbc7188650
2019-12-27 02:58:25 +00:00
Bonian Chen
b0bddfec15
Merge "[Settings] Replace getSimCount() API"
2019-12-27 02:45:42 +00:00
Automerger Merge Worker
a58c7ba27a
Merge "[Settings] Replace #getServiceStateForSubscriber with #getServiceState" am: e8cf63ddd3 am: 8ead010c08
...
Change-Id: I558dad7bbc41bc1dc30a72665da0d96e263e67ed
2019-12-26 14:15:29 +00:00
Zoey Chen
e8cf63ddd3
Merge "[Settings] Replace #getServiceStateForSubscriber with #getServiceState"
2019-12-26 13:44:58 +00:00
Automerger Merge Worker
b206208982
Merge "[Settings] Replace #getSubscriberId(I) with #getSubscriberId()" am: 47634431c6 am: 4359db040c
...
Change-Id: I2489531d3b940c6de8ad0805fc138a66b1607ba2
2019-12-26 13:11:36 +00:00
Zoey Chen
47634431c6
Merge "[Settings] Replace #getSubscriberId(I) with #getSubscriberId()"
2019-12-26 12:01:22 +00:00
Bonian Chen
b373aeedfe
[Settings] Replace getSimCount() API
...
Change design of monitor change in Settings.Global.MOBILE_DATA and
Settings.Global.DATA_ROAMING in order to avoid from accessing
getSimCount().
Bug: 144251589
Test: make RunSettingsRoboTests -j ROBOTEST_FILTER=RoamingPreferenceControllerTest
Change-Id: If50c57e7c1b27f9a0baf2bd46cc0930e0a0be2bd
2019-12-26 19:02:57 +08:00
Automerger Merge Worker
3d73b7a832
Merge "[Settings] Replace #getSubIdForPhoneAccount with #getSubscriptionId" am: 047dd2dff9 am: 3835293aea
...
Change-Id: I9750d2b07e3b6280d2e3e9e2779f2740d24f0cdf
2019-12-26 09:55:38 +00:00
Zoey Chen
047dd2dff9
Merge "[Settings] Replace #getSubIdForPhoneAccount with #getSubscriptionId"
2019-12-26 09:36:58 +00:00
zoey chen
fc3ddb2f16
[Settings] Replace #getServiceStateForSubscriber with #getServiceState
...
Bug: 146821501
Test: make RunSettingsRoboTests -j ROBOTEST_FILTER=RenameMobileNetworkDialogFragmentTest
Change-Id: I8a1819b70a8d4ec56ae40f2b8b613bcd65a12b11
Merged-In: I8a1819b70a8d4ec56ae40f2b8b613bcd65a12b11
2019-12-26 17:12:42 +08:00
Automerger Merge Worker
631a1d206c
Merge "[Settings] Replace #getSimCount with #getActiveModemCount" am: 171eabcb2d am: 22c2c14605
...
Change-Id: Ic45f318e6784205e88a13f8a2fdf7fcdb04c9955
2019-12-26 04:17:42 +00:00
Automerger Merge Worker
c5d575f085
Merge "[Settings] Replace TelephonyManager#from()" am: 98e6ab358b am: 4be4ae6a75
...
Change-Id: Ie2daa594c252d71e63125108036a4428563bed5b
2019-12-26 04:17:28 +00:00
Zoey Chen
171eabcb2d
Merge "[Settings] Replace #getSimCount with #getActiveModemCount"
2019-12-26 03:44:47 +00:00
Bonian Chen
98e6ab358b
Merge "[Settings] Replace TelephonyManager#from()"
2019-12-26 03:36:09 +00:00